Advertising Standards Board Members

(several part-time positions)

The Advertising Standards Board (the Board) is responsible for considering complaints made by members of the public about advertisements. The Board considers complaints made about advertisements against the Australian Association of National Advertisers (AANA) Advertiser Code of Ethics, the AANA Code for Advertising to Children, the Federal Chamber of Automotive Industries Voluntary Code for Motor Vehicle Advertising, and the AANA Food and Beverages Advertising and Marketing Communications Code.

The Board was established by the advertising industry as a means of providing a public and transparent complaints consideration process about advertisements. The Board meets in Sydney one day per month to consider advertisements and the complaints made about them. Total remuneration of $700 (gross) per meeting is payable and appointments are for three year terms.

Applications are encouraged from people living outside Sydney and travel expenses to and from Sydney will be met. Applications are also invited from persons with diverse cultural and professional backgrounds.

The Board operates as a team of people who reflect the opinions of ordinary members of the community, articulate their own views, and appreciate the views of other members of the Board. The Board is not intended to be a team of advertising experts. Membership of the Board is on an individual basis, not as representatives of industry, consumer or special interest groups.

Persons interested in applying should provide a statement of their work and community experience and a short application (preferably no more than two pages) addressing each of the following matters:

  1. Ability to interpret Codes in applying the standards generally accepted by reasonable adults in the public interest
  2. Demonstrated involvement in the community and the ability to reflect broad community standards
  3. Ability to apply reason, common sense and sensitivity when assessing a wide variety of material
  4. Demonstrated ability to work as part of a diverse team.
